Course Content

• Precision Medicine: An Introduction to Genomics and its Implications
• Health Policy and Regulation in Precision Medicine (Includes keywords: *Policy, Regulation, Legislation*)
• Ethical, Legal, and Social Implications (ELSI) of Precision Medicine
• Data Privacy and Security in Precision Medicine (Includes keywords: *Data Security, HIPAA, GDPR*)
• The Economics of Precision Medicine: Cost-Effectiveness and Value Assessment
• Clinical Implementation of Precision Medicine: Case Studies and Best Practices
• Precision Medicine and Public Health: Population Screening and Prevention
• Global Health Perspectives on Precision Medicine (Includes keywords: *Global Health, Equity, Access*)

Career path

Career Role in Precision Medicine Health Policy (UK) Description
Precision Medicine Consultant Develops and implements precision medicine strategies within healthcare systems, focusing on policy and regulatory frameworks. High demand for strategic thinking and policy expertise.
Bioinformatics Analyst (Health Policy Focus) Analyzes large genomic datasets to inform health policy decisions related to precision medicine. Requires strong analytical skills and understanding of genomic data.
Health Economist (Precision Medicine) Evaluates the cost-effectiveness and economic impact of precision medicine interventions and policies. Requires expertise in health economics and precision medicine.
Regulatory Affairs Specialist (Genomics) Navigates the regulatory landscape for new genomic technologies and precision medicine therapies. Requires in-depth knowledge of relevant regulations.
